My quick tip is this: Yes, you will take some adjustment to organising your own day and staying motivated. Yes, you will feel lonely sometimes so you must find portals of connection with others – be it a yoga class, a writing group, or a part time job which keeps you connected to others and also serves as security as you slowly position yourself as a writer or editor.
